1972 Ford Gran Torino vs. 1985 Mazda RX-7

To start off, 1985 Mazda RX-7 is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Ford Gran Torino.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Ford Gran Torino would be higher. At 6,553 cc (8 cylinders), 1972 Ford Gran Torino is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1972 Ford Gran Torino (168 HP @ 4200 RPM) has 64 more horse power than 1985 Mazda RX-7. (104 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1972 Ford Gran Torino should accelerate faster than 1985 Mazda RX-7.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1972 Ford Gran Torino weights approximately 954 kg more than 1985 Mazda RX-7.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1972 Ford Gran Torino (403 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 258 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Mazda RX-7. (145 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1972 Ford Gran Torino will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Mazda RX-7. 1972 Ford Gran Torino has automatic transmission and 1985 Mazda RX-7 has manual transmission. 1985 Mazda RX-7 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1972 Ford Gran Torino will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1972 Ford Gran Torino 1985 Mazda RX-7
Make Ford Mazda
Model Gran Torino RX-7
Year Released 1972 1985
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 6553 cc 2292 cc
Engine Type V dual-disk rotary
Horse Power 168 HP 104 HP
Engine RPM 4200 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 403 Nm 145 Nm
Torque RPM 2200 RPM 4000 RPM
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 2014 kg 1060 kg
Vehicle Length 5470 mm 4290 mm
Vehicle Width 2010 mm 1680 mm
Vehicle Height 1400 mm 1270 mm
Wheelbase Size 3000 mm 2430 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 76 L 65 L
